140 miles and all's... well... better...

Today I drove my SVX 140 miles for the first time in over a year. Here's my updated status report.

Well, first of all it's still throwing a check-engine light despite having replaced the cam position sensor I thought might be bad. I just posted about this here.

Beyond that, she ran great. When starting up the engine warm she's tending to stumble a little for a moment before catching... that could be water in the fuel I guess. Anyone else any thoughts on that one?

The wheel bearing noise is definitely gone. Drove at 60-65 for over an hour through Missouri and Illinois (South on 270, 255 up through Illinois back onto 270 West and finally back down 40 to Chesterfield Valley for lunch at Kaldi's). She rode straight and true the entire way, no sign of problems. Saw a black SVX on 270 up in the 270 / 170 interchange area... anyone here? Very dark tinted windows... I'm sure my tinted windows didn't help... but I couldn't see the driver.

Anyway... on a positive note I have to report that the smell of burning popcorn appears to be abating. I guess it was just crud in the exhaust burning off, or maybe a rodent nest in the muffler. I may never know... but nothing seems to be burning any more. Maybe too early to tell; it's a windy and cold day. However, every time I stopped at lights after my run I cracked the window a smidgen to see if I could smell anything... nothing out of the ordinary. Then when I got home I bent down behind the exhaust pipes and could smell nothing unusual. I'm keeping my fingers crossed on that one.

Don't know if the water problem remains... the exhaust tips look dry inside so I'm making the assumption at the moment that the water problem has also abated with a bit of driving. However, it's been raining today so it'd be tough to tell. I'll keep an eye on this and report back.

For now... a successful and rather relaxing drive. Next step; she's got an appointment on Thursday afternoon to have the muffler taken out and replaced with a salvaged muffler I got over a year ago... and a state inspection so I can get the tags updated.

I'll keep the group abreast of changes... any feedback greatly appreciated!
